Angielskifrancuskihiszpański

Ad


Ulubiona usługa OnWorks

docbook-2-pdf - Online w chmurze

Uruchom dokument docbook-2-pdf u bezpłatnego dostawcy hostingu OnWorks w systemie Ubuntu Online, Fedora Online, emulatorze online systemu Windows lub emulatorze online systemu MAC OS

To jest polecenie docbook-2-pdf, które można uruchomić w bezpłatnym dostawcy hostingu OnWorks przy użyciu jednej z naszych wielu bezpłatnych stacji roboczych online, takich jak Ubuntu Online, Fedora Online, emulator online systemu Windows lub emulator online systemu MAC OS

PROGRAM:

IMIĘ


sgml2x — łatwo formatuje dokumenty SGML/XML przy użyciu arkuszy stylów DSSSL

STRESZCZENIE


sgml2x [Opcje] [plik sgml | plik xml ]

klasa dokumentów-2-format docelowy [Opcje] [plik sgml | plik xml ]

Opis


sgml2x pozwala łatwo sformatować dokument SGML lub XML przy użyciu arkuszy stylów DSSSL oraz
zapewnia następujące funkcje:

· Wiele możliwych arkuszy stylów na klasę dokumentu

· Łatwa specyfikacja arkuszy stylów przy użyciu aliasów, z obsługą parametrów
dziedzictwo

· Łatwa integracja nowych arkuszy stylów poprzez dodanie prostego nowego pliku definicji w formacie
katalog konfiguracyjny

· Osoba dzwoniąca może określić podobną do PATH listę katalogów konfiguracyjnych, domyślnie do
katalogi konfiguracyjne dla całego systemu, dla użytkownika i dla projektu

· Automatyczny wybór domyślnego arkusza stylów do użycia na podstawie przypisanego
Priorytety

· Przekaż dowolne opcje do jadeit(1)

Klasa dokumentu używana do wyszukiwania arkuszy stylów i format wyjściowy jest na razie
pochodzi tylko od nazwy, pod którą program jest wywoływany, więc będziesz chciał to nazwać
program za pomocą dowiązań symbolicznych, takich jak docbook-2-pdf.

sgml2x jest zaimplementowany jako opakowanie powłoki jadeit(1) (lub najlepiej otwarty jadeit(1),
chociaż używamy nazwy ogólnej jadeit w całej dokumentacji), jadeteks(1) i inne
narzędzia.

Jeżeli nie ma jadetex.cfg plik w pobliżu dokumentu, kopiowany jest domyślny, który umożliwia
produkcja zakładek PDF.

Opcje


-c|--katalog katalog
Użyj podanego katalogu SGML zamiast domyślnego systemu.

-C|--confdirs lista katalogów
Użyj (rozdzielonej spacjami) listy katalogów konfiguracyjnych. Ta opcja jest
kumulatywnie, tzn. można użyć kilku -C opcje i listy będą
połączone.

Elementy listy należy uporządkować według najbardziej ogólnej konfiguracji (np. obejmującej cały system)
do najbardziej szczegółowych (np. obejmujących cały projekt).

Jeśli za pomocą tej opcji udostępniony zostanie jakikolwiek katalog, zostanie domyślna lista katalogów
ignorowane.

-D|--dssslproc procesor dsssl
Zastosowanie procesor dsssl aby zastosować arkusz stylów zamiast domyślnego. Ten
procesor musi obsługiwać jadeit-podobne opcje, takie jak -V.

Gdy ta opcja nie jest dostępna, pierwsza znaleziona w pliku dssslproc pliki z confdirs to
zajęty. Widzieć "Pliki" by uzyskać więcej szczegółów.

-h|--help Wyświetl komunikat pomocy i wyjdź.

-j|--jadeit procesor dsssl
Przestarzały synonim słowa --dssslproc.

--jadetexfilter filtr perla
Przetwórz dane wyjściowe jadetex za pomocą filtra perla.

Może to być przydatne do wymuszenia podziału strony w określonych miejscach w celu pokonania arkusza stylów
problemy, lub wymuszać dzielenie wyrazów tam, gdzie TeX nie ma wystarczającej liczby wzorców, lub robić żadnych
inna sprytna transformacja, o której byś pomyślał.

Zobacz przykłady/wiersze poleceń plik do możliwych zastosowań.

-n|--brak działania
Drukuj polecenia zamiast je uruchamiać. Przydatne do nauki o niższym poziomie
narzędzi i do debugowania wiersza poleceń.

-o|--openjade
To zdjęcie opcja is przestarzały. otwarty jadeit jest teraz wartością domyślną, jeśli jest dostępna. Używać
--dssslproc lub dssslproc plik konfiguracyjny, aby wymusić określony procesor.

Ta opcja była używana otwarty jadeit(1) jako procesor DSSSL zamiast jadeit(1).

-O|--jadeopty jade-opcje
Dodatkowe opcje do przejścia jadeit(1). Ta opcja kumuluje się, możesz
określ kilka z nich, podane opcje zostaną połączone.

-q|--cichy
Ustaw gadatliwość na cichy

-r|--uwagi
Renderuj treść uwag do dokumentu w dokumencie (uwagę elementy w
Dokument 4, komentarz elementy w DocBook 3), dzięki czemu wytworzony wynik jest an
do użytku wewnętrznego dokument, drukując pogrubione ostrzeżenie na okładce.

Jest to funkcja specyficzna dla klasy docclass i arkusza stylów i nie wszystkie arkusze stylów będą z niej korzystać
to.

-s|--styl styl
Wybierz styl wyjściowy, aby zastąpić domyślny (ewentualnie pochodzący z dokumentu).

Dostępne są obecnie style dla określonej klasy dokumentów i dla każdego formatu wyjściowego
zależy od zawartości katalogów konfiguracyjnych i może być wyświetlany z rozszerzeniem
--help opcja.

Zauważ, że dobrą praktyką jest określenie tej opcji w procedurze kompilacji, aby uzyskać
powtarzalne wyniki niezależnie od dostępnych arkuszy stylów.

-v|--gadatliwy
Zwiększ gadatliwość. Tę opcję można określić wielokrotnie.

--gadatliwość N
Ustaw gadatliwość na N. Poziomy gadatliwości są zdefiniowane w następujący sposób:

cichy Tylko błędy w druku

domyślnym Drukuj tylko błędy i ostrzeżenia

gadatliwy Drukuj również ogłoszenia

wyśledzić Drukuj także ważne polecenia podczas ich uruchamiania (np --brak działania czy).

debug Drukuj również komunikaty debugowania

-V|--wersja
Wydrukuj wersję programu i wyjdź.

systemu


sgml2x używa drzewa katalogów konfiguracyjnych zamiast pliku konfiguracyjnego, więc tak jest
łatwe podłączanie innych pakietów przy niskim ryzyku uszkodzenia istniejącej konfiguracji.

Hierarchie stylów znajdują się w katalogach o nazwie style w każdej konfiguracji
informator. Stare wersje tego programu służyły do ​​umieszczania tych hierarchii bezpośrednio w pliku
katalogi konfiguracyjne.

Katalog konfiguracyjny zawiera jeden katalog dla każdej znanej klasy dokumentów o nazwie
pseudonim klasy dokumentu (np dokumentacja). Te katalogi docclass zawierają jeden pod-
katalog dla każdej klasy formatu wyjściowego (obecnie tylko html i są obsługiwane).

Obecnie problemy z implementacją wymuszają ograniczenie pseudonimów dla klas dokumentów
i arkusze stylów: mogą zawierać tylko znaki alfanumeryczne i podkreślenia. Ten
ograniczenie może zostać usunięte w przyszłej wersji, ale nie nastąpi to wcześniej
skrypt zostanie przepisany w innym języku.

Każdy z tych katalogów zawiera jeden plik na dostępny styl. Nazwy tych plików
mogą zawierać tylko znaki alfanumeryczne i są używane jako pseudonimy dla stylów. Ten
plik zawiera linie z a klawisz: wartość wzór, przy czym następujące klucze są obecnie
utrzymany:

Id Publiczny identyfikator arkusza stylów

asc Krótki opis stylów, które mają być wyświetlane w komunikacie pomocy

pdfZastąp, psOverride,
rtfOverride, mifZastąp" 10 Symbol dsssl z arkusza stylów wydruku do ustawienia
do #t (lub a symbol=wartość para, odpowiednia jako argument do jadeit's -V opcja),
do wykorzystania w danym formacie wydruku.

Dozwolony jest tylko jeden symbol na linię nadpisania. Aby zdefiniować wartości dla kilku symboli, użyj
kilka linii.

Dziedziczy Pseudonim arkusza stylów, z którego ten dziedziczy, aby uniknąć niepotrzebnego
powielanie definicji stylu.

Obecnie powoduje to tylko dziedziczenie *Nadpisanie parametry.

Priorytet Dodatnia liczba całkowita ułatwiająca wybór domyślnego stylu, gdy nie można go wybrać
pochodzi z dokumentu. Wyższe wartości mają większe szanse na bycie wziętym za
domyślny. Zadbaj o używanie niskich priorytetów dla hiper-wyspecjalizowanych stylów dla a
ogólny typ dokumentu, aby nie został użyty przez pomyłkę.

Na przykład bieżąca zalecana polityka dotycząca arkuszy stylów DocBook, wywodząca się z
Norman Walsh jest następujący (i może ulec zmianie, jeśli doświadczenie okaże się niewystarczające).

10 Podstawowe arkusze stylów, które zwykle muszą być dostosowane.

0 Każdy arkusz stylów, który został napisany w celu hiperspecjalistycznym (np
marketingowa karta produktu).

1000 Domyślny styl dla wszystkich dokumentów tworzonych przez organizację. zwykle
lekka personalizacja, obejmująca preferencje układu, organizacji
logo lub coś w tym stylu.

10-100 Różne ogólne dostosowania podstawowych arkuszy stylów.

Kiedy piszesz ulepszoną wersję arkusza stylów z priorytetem n, Ty
zwykle chcą wybrać wyższy priorytet.

Akta


/etc/sgml/sgml2x/

~/.sgml2x/

./sgml2x/ Domyślne katalogi konfiguracyjne, w których znajdują się pliki konfiguracyjne
szukałem. Zobacz dokumentację dot --confdirs by uzyskać więcej szczegółów.

poufać/styl/
Hierarchia definiująca użyteczne style. Widzieć "Konfiguracja" więcej
detale.

poufać/dssslproc
Plik zawierający uporządkowaną listę procesorów dsssl do wyszukania, oddzielonych od siebie
nowe linie i/lub spacje. Linie zaczynające się od a # charakter traktuje się jako
uwagi. Wspólne wartości to m.in otwarty jadeit i jadeit.

Określone tutaj procesory DSSSL powinny akceptować -V i -D kompatybilny z jadeitem
opcje wiersza polecenia.

Katalogi konfiguracyjne są przeszukiwane począwszy od najbardziej szczegółowych
jeden, dzięki czemu przy domyślnych confdirs ustawienia projektu mogą zastąpić użytkownika
ustawień, które z kolei mogą zastąpić ustawienia systemowe.

Specjalna wartość fałszywy można użyć do zatrzymania wyszukiwania i uniemożliwienia zaglądania
bardziej ogólne katalogi. Jeśli na przykład projekt musi używać
openjade-1.4devel polecenie i żadne inne, może określić openjade-1.4devel fałszywy
w tym dssslproc plik.

Ostrzeżenia


Podczas używania openjade-1.4devel jako procesor DSSSL, zobaczysz skargę na top-
obiekt przepływu poziomu generowany przez typ_doc.dsloraz automatyczne określanie dokumentu
typu nie powiedzie się. Poza tym ten błąd jest nieszkodliwy. Pomysły, jak sobie z tym poradzić, lub
potwierdzenie tego openjade-1.4devel jest zbyt surowy, zostanie doceniony :)

Połączenia przyszłość


Planowane funkcje dla przyszłych wydań obejmują:

· Integracja generatora indeksów

· Integracja ładnego silnika drukowania dla przykładów kodu

· Specyfikacja przekształceń, które mają być powiązane

· Deklaracja podzbioru docclasses, aby umożliwić użycie z dowolną docclass stylu-
arkusze, które mają zastosowanie do jego docclass nadzbiorów.

· Pracuj w tymczasowej lokalizacji, aby nie zanieczyszczać katalogu roboczego
pliki tymczasowe. To nie jest tak proste, jak się wydaje, ponieważ psuje dokument
odnosi się do plików obrazów przy użyciu ścieżek względnych. To może być postrzegane jako jadeitowy błąd,
jednak.

Przejrzyj pełną listę TODO i prześlij nam więcej pomysłów!

prawo autorskie


Prawa autorskie © 2001-2003 Alcove & Yann Dirson.

sgml2x jest na licencji GNU General Public License, wersja 2.

Niniejsza dokumentacja jest objęta licencją GNU Free Documentation License, wersja 1.

Kontakt us


sgml2x jest częścią AlkowaKsiążka projekt (połączyć do URL http://www.alcove-
labs.org/en/software/alcovebook/) . Proszę użyć AlkowaKsiążka pocztowy wykazy (połączyć do URL
https://savannah.gnu.org/mail/?group_id=533) aby skontaktować się z programistami i użytkownikami.

Lista błędów i propozycji funkcji jest dostępna przez a Sieć Interfejs (połączyć do URL
https://savannah.gnu.org/support/?group_id=533) . Użyj go do zgłaszania problemów i
pomysły.

See również


otwarty jadeit(1), jadeit(1), jadeteks(1), collateindex.pl(1).

sgml2x(1)

Skorzystaj z dokumentu docbook-2-pdf online, korzystając z usług onworks.net


Darmowe serwery i stacje robocze

Pobierz aplikacje Windows i Linux

  • 1
    Program ładujący Clover EFI
    Program ładujący Clover EFI
    Projekt został przeniesiony do
    https://github.com/CloverHackyColor/CloverBootloader..
    Funkcje: Uruchom system macOS, Windows i Linux
    w trybie UEFI lub starszym na komputerze Mac lub PC z
    UE...
    Pobierz program ładujący Clover EFI
  • 2
    zjednoczone obroty
    zjednoczone obroty
    Dołącz do nas w Gitterze!
    https://gitter.im/unitedrpms-people/Lobby
    Włącz repozytorium URPMS w swoim
    system -
    https://github.com/UnitedRPMs/unitedrpms.github.io/bl...
    Pobierz unitedrpms
  • 3
    Zwiększ biblioteki C ++
    Zwiększ biblioteki C ++
    Boost zapewnia bezpłatne przenośne
    recenzowane biblioteki C++. The
    nacisk kładziony jest na przenośne biblioteki, które
    dobrze współpracuje z biblioteką standardową C++.
    Zobacz http://www.bo...
    Pobierz biblioteki Boost C++
  • 4
    WirtualnyGL
    WirtualnyGL
    VirtualGL przekierowuje polecenia 3D z a
    Unix/Linux OpenGL na a
    GPU po stronie serwera i konwertuje plik
    renderowane obrazy 3D do strumienia wideo
    z którym ...
    Pobierz VirtualGL
  • 5
    libusba
    libusba
    Biblioteka, aby włączyć przestrzeń użytkownika
    programy użytkowe do komunikacji
    Urządzenia USB. Publiczność: deweloperzy, koniec
    Użytkownicy/Pulpit. Język programowania: C.
    Kategorie...
    Pobierz plik libusb
  • 6
    HAUST
    HAUST
    SWIG to narzędzie do tworzenia oprogramowania
    która łączy programy napisane w C i
    C++ z różnymi wysokopoziomowymi
    języki programowania. SWIG jest używany z
    różne...
    Pobierz SWIG
  • więcej »

Komendy systemu Linux

Ad